Allows you to remove any element from a website. Temporarily or permanently. Be it an advertisment missed by your ad-blocker, fixed menu, distracting GIF image, overly animated slideshow or anything else getting in your way.

Features:

- easily remove multiple elements in a row (no need for a cumbersome context menu)

- highlights elements under the cursor

- customizable keyboard shortcut for activation

- remember removed elements for a particular website or hide only temporarily

It was a little too aggressive. One particular website with which I wanted to use this extension wraps each image in "span" tags. They prevent the usual actions for contextual menus on the images. I'd like a tool to remove the wrapper "span" element without affecting the image it contains. However, this extension hid the wrapper and the image, so it was not helpful to me. I'd also like the extension to add a contextual menu item. That way, on pages which don't disable the menu, I could right-click on a page element and select "remove element" from the menu. That would be faster than selecting the extension's toolbar icon, which activates it until deactivated again. (More inconvenient clicks.)
